Transaction 849466c4c62ab996e73263d724c28bec4fa53681009ecd46b9fbc74e53e66cf7
1 Input
1 Output
-
849466c4c62ab996e73263d724c28bec4fa53681009ecd46b9fbc74e53e66cf7:0
- value
- 133981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2834ef82b1065be160b9ffb6ac8e36a16db4c9a OP_EQUAL
- address
- 3HxuWANFBt37RaogGSvVoaoSkvTBEGCk9s